Compression Test Results

A thorough compression test is critical for evaluating the condition of an R32 engine, as it provides important insights into its internal state. This test measures the pressure produced in each cylinder, revealing the engine's ability to preserve adequate compression levels. In most cases, well-functioning R32 engines should exhibit consistent compression values across all cylinders, generally ranging between 140 to 180 psi. Notable variations may signal concerns such as deteriorated piston rings, cylinder head damage, or valve deterioration. Reduced compression in one or more cylinders can indicate potential repair needs, affecting long-term performance and durability. As a result, interested buyers should focus on compression test results when assessing an R32 engine to guarantee they are investing wisely.

Oil Leak Diagnosis

Examining for oil leaks functions as a crucial step in assessing the condition of an R32 engine. In many cases, leaks can suggest internal concerns like worn seals, gaskets, or components. Conducting a visual examination is key; search for oil buildup around the engine block, oil pan, and valve covers. Pay attention to any pooling or dripping oil beneath the vehicle, as this can suggest a more significant problem. Using a flashlight can assist in uncovering concealed leaks. Additionally, checking the oil level regularly can indicate whether oil is being burned or depleted unexpectedly. Addressing oil leaks promptly can prevent further damage and guarantee the engine operates efficiently, making it a significant element to evaluate when buying an R32 engine.

How to Examine Your R32 Engine's Physical State

When evaluating an R32 engine's physical condition, it is critical to perform a comprehensive examination to detect any indicators of deterioration or damage. Start by inspecting the motor block for cracks, rust, or corrosion, which can suggest negligence or significant problems. Examine the oil for any contamination; any milky coloration may signal a head gasket failure. Inspect the timing belt and accessory belts for fraying or cracks, as these elements are vital for proper engine function.

Assess the status of hoses and connections, looking for signs of deterioration or leaks. A thorough visual check of the exhaust system can uncover corrosion or holes that may affect engine performance. Pay attention to abnormal sounds when firing up the engine, as they can point to internal engine issues. Lastly, inspect the attachment points for any evidence of misalignment, which can signal past accidents or improper installation. This extensive evaluation will help evaluate the engine's overall reliability and lifespan.
